Year: 1992 Source: Journal of the American Academy of Child & Adolescent Psychiatry, v.31, no.2, (Mar. 1992), p.298-305 SIEC No: 19920237

In this study, kinetic constants of platelet imipramine binding were determined in youths with major depression & controls. Those who were actively depressed had significantly fewer imipramine binding sites (B-max) than recovering depressives & controls. Actively depressed males, but not females, had fewer imipramine binding sites than both of their sex-matched comparison groups. Neither age, Tanner stage or circannual rhythms influenced B-max, but suicidality may be associated with low B-max.
